I assume you mean Hochstein inactive because he's injured. Otherwise he's their top G/C backup and a goal line blocking TE. Or do you think Yates has passed him in that regard?
Well, Hochstein survived past the first injury report, so now it's most recent practice time which still tilts to Yates. I consider Russ ahead of Billy in the interior reserve race by virture of his proven ability to start at Center and Guard, where Billy has only gotten three starts at Guard. I suspect the gap between them had closed considerably when Billy was given a three year deal last Spring. If it was me (and be thankful it's not) I'd still hold Russ out of this game to give him an extra week of rest and practice before San Diego. I would also do the same with Mike Wright even though he isn't listed here...the depth at DL is not good right now.

Looks like you favor the Lingering Injury theory of who don't play.
Perceptive as usual! If you look at the roster, there just doesn't seem to be any obvious players with whom you might question their skill set for this game. Brown and Herron are the exceptions, and both would be good on Special Teams (I've started slo-motioning the last Minny preseason game and Herron is in on all STs, he isn't making big plays, but he's in the right place each time - I'm getting good vibes so far). That leaves getting players healthy as the primary reason for sitting them. I think the biggest challenge is to determine who gets cut Saturday to bring Santonio up for the game. I'm leaning toward Baker, which means we need another inactive...or they could go with James since he would have the right to decline another team's offer.
